Police crash reports

Your truck accident claim will be based on police crash reports. Insurance companies use them to determine the fault of the driver and calculate compensation claims. However, the report may not accurately reflect the facts of the incident. It is essential to examine the accuracy of the police report, and to contact the officer investigating the case if required.

The police report on the crash contains several important details regarding the incident. It also includes the officer's assessment of the causes of the crash and the contributory factors. These factors could include bad weather, speeding, not working brake lights or turn signals, or even turn signals that are not working. Traffic laws that are violated are also reported in police crash reports. These reports are not legally binding, but they have importance. If you're not satisfied with the information contained in the report, then you can appeal the report to the appropriate judge.

The police report on a crash will contain the police officer's written opinion about the reason for the crash, details about witnesses and the positions of each party who was involved in the incident. The report will also contain an outline of where the crash took place and the location of the collision. These documents are typically completed within a few days. The documents may be made public by some jurisdictions, while others are only available to the drivers involved. The outcome of your injury case may be affected by the nature of the police crash report.

Police crash reports are an essential element of evidence in your truck accident claim. They contain vital information that will allow you to get an equitable settlement. These reports often include details on injuries and citations. They may also include photos of the scene.
